TSLR vs. PLTM - Expense Ratio Comparison

TSLR has a 1.50% expense ratio, which is higher than PLTM's 0.50% expense ratio.

Correlation

The correlation between TSLR and PLTM is 0.15,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

TSLR vs. PLTM -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um TSLR drawdown since its inception was -82.80%, which is greater than PLTM's maximum drawdown of -42.32%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for TSLR and PLTM.
